"Tucked between Fifth and Madison Avenues on the Upper East Side, the Mark is a luxe, design-forward hotel whose Jacques Grange interiors and doorstep location—minutes from Central Park, the Metropolitan Museum of Art, and the Guggenheim—define a quintessential Manhattan stay; its standout asset is chief concierge Maria Wittorp, a Stockholm-born hospitality veteran who, after starting as a butler in 1991, now crafts highly personalized, behind-the-scenes New York experiences for guests (rooms from $1,250). The hotel arranges everything from private after-hours museum access and Jean-Georges picnics in the park to sunset sails aboard its vintage 70-foot Herreshoff and VIP shopping moments, all calibrated to individual interests and often requiring 48–72 hours’ notice." - John Wogan
